Society and Environment offers students a diverse range of learning opportunities that develop students’ understanding of how and why individuals and groups live together; interact with and within their environment; manage resources; and create institutions and systems. Students learn that over time all these may change.

Our learning environment aims to develop students who are well-informed critical thinkers. Strong emphasis is placed on developing a solid understanding of the importance of ecological sustainability and active citizenship. Evidence of this learning could be an entertaining Year 4 assembly item on biodiversity and another is the College’s annual participation in “Clean-Up Australia” Day.

Courses offered in Years 8 and 9 include aspects of the disciplines of History, Geography, Politics and Economics. These courses are available as individual units in Year 10 so that students gain a solid understanding of these disciplines which assists them in making informed choices for further study and work. Years 11 and 12 students may study History, Geography, Economics and Political and Legal Studies.

Courses are strongly skills focussed with emphasis on inquiry, analysis, research, interpretation and communication. Students work in collaborative learning environments, which develop social skills in such areas as learning to work and negotiate with others. A variety of assessment strategies are employed to meet the individual needs of students and include library research assignments; timelines; map and graph construction; field-work reports; analysis of documents; data analysis; oral exercises; and role plays.

Values are an inherent part of Society and Environment and we assist students to develop both individual and group values. Students are encouraged to develop a positive self-concept, confident attitude and to develop empathy, compassion and tolerance for all people and to respect and care for the environment.
